Everyone is born a slave of sin. Jesus Christ said, “Most assuredly, I say to you, whoever commits sin is a slave of sin” (John 8:34). We cannot free ourselves from this oppressive master, for no one can live without sinning against God. But the sinless Jesus – not for His own sake, but for others – came from Heaven to deliver His people. Jesus allowed godless men to nail Him to a Roman cross, and three days later rose from the dead so that “we should no longer be slaves of sin” (Romans 6:6). And all those who trust in His work (and not their own) as the way to freedom will find emancipation from sin. “Therefore,” declared Jesus, “if the Son makes you free, you shall be free indeed” (John 8:36).

Cranberry Nut Bread – Abm

0
(0)
CATEGORY CUISINE TAG YIELD
Dairy, Grains Breadmaker 1 Loaf

INGREDIENTS

9 oz Slightly warm water
1/2 c Frozen cranberries
1 1/2 tb Unsalted butter
1 1/2 tb White sugar
1 tb Brown sugar
1 1/2 ts Salt
1 c Whole wheat flour
1 tb Rounded, nonfat dry milk powder
1/4 ts Cinnamon
1/8 ts Nutmeg
1/8 ts Clove
1 1/2 ts Yeast
2/3 c Chopped walnuts

INSTRUCTIONS

Place the water and the cranberries in the bread machine. Let the
cranberries thaw while you get the other ingredients together. Add the
other ingredients in the order recommended for your bread machine. Check
the mixture as it kneads, to adjust water or flour for the right
consistency.  Bake on Sweet or Basic cycle.
